The charges against Cioffi and Tannin are tied to the management - and eventual implosion - of two Bear Stearns hedge funds known as the Bear Stearns High Grade Structured Credit Strategies Fund and the Bear Stearns High Grade Structured Credit Strategies Enhanced Leverage Fund. [read post]

Reuters is reporting that Bear Stearns has been hit with its first arbitration over the losses in two of its hedge funds.According to Reuters, the claimant lost $500,000 and is blaming Bear for misleading him about its exposure to subprime mortgages.While it appears that investor losses from subprime lending are going to be significant, the mere fact that an investor lost money in funds investing in such vehicles does not necessarily mean that there is a viable claim against the broker or… [read post]
